City Council Study Session Minutes <br />Wednesday, January 10, 2018 <br />Page 2 of 2 <br />D. EXECUTIVE SESSION <br />President Younger announced that Council would recess for a 30 -Minute Executive Session <br />from 7:54 to 8:24 PM to "Evaluate the Applications for an Appointment' allowed under RCW <br />42.30.110(1)(g); and that action would be taken when back in session. <br />The Executive Session was extended for 10 more minutes... At 8:34 PM, the Council <br />reconvened... <br />E. APPOINTMENT OF DISTRICT 4 COUNCIL MEMBER – To serve until the results of the next <br />Municipal General Election on November 5, 2019 are certified. <br />President Younger opened nominations. <br />Pat Sullivan nominated Jaime L. Forsyth. <br />Richard Huddy nominated Tony Hillman. <br />With no further nominations, President Younger asked for a vote by signed ballot. <br />Voted in Favor of Forsyth: Sullivan, Goodnow, Younger <br />Voted in Favor of Hillman: Daugs, Gorman, Huddy <br />Due to a 3 to 3 tie, President Younger requested a second vote. <br />Voted in Favor of Forsyth: Goodnow, Younger <br />Voted in Favor of Hillman: Sullivan, Daugs, Gorman, Huddy <br />By a vote of 4 to 2, Tony Hillman was appointed as the District 4 Council Member. <br />President Younger announced that newly appointed District 4 Council Member Tony Hillman <br />would be Sworn In at the January 17, 2018 Council Meeting. President Younger then called a <br />recess at 08.50 PM... At 9:00 PM, the meeting reconvened in Council Conference Room 603... <br />F.
